A quadratic polynomial with zeroes -2 and 3, is:

A

`3x^2 - 2x + 6`

B

`2x^2 + 3x - 6 `

C

`x^2 -2x + 6`

D

`x^2 -x - 6`

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
To find a quadratic polynomial with given zeroes, we can follow these steps: ### Step 1: Identify the Zeroes The zeroes of the quadratic polynomial are given as -2 and 3. Let's denote these zeroes as: - α = -2 - β = 3 ### Step 2: Use the Relationship Between Zeroes and Coefficients For a quadratic polynomial in the standard form \( f(x) = ax^2 + bx + c \), the relationships between the zeroes and the coefficients are: - Sum of the zeroes (α + β) = -b/a - Product of the zeroes (αβ) = c/a ### Step 3: Calculate the Sum and Product of the Zeroes Now, let's calculate the sum and product of the zeroes: - Sum (α + β) = -2 + 3 = 1 - Product (αβ) = (-2) * 3 = -6 ### Step 4: Write the Quadratic Polynomial Using the relationships derived from the zeroes: - The quadratic polynomial can be expressed as: \[ f(x) = a(x^2 - (α + β)x + αβ) \] Substituting the values we found: \[ f(x) = a(x^2 - 1x - 6) \] Assuming \( a = 1 \) (the simplest case), we have: \[ f(x) = x^2 - x - 6 \] ### Step 5: Final Result Thus, the required quadratic polynomial is: \[ f(x) = x^2 - x - 6 \]
